Book Description
An Introduction to Polymer Science and Chemistry: The field of polymer science and technology has evolved into a dynamic and essential area of study, influencing numerous industries and aspects of daily life. This multi-author volume, “An Introduction to Polymer Science and Technology,” aims to provide a comprehensive overview of the fundamental principles, methodologies, and applications of polymers. It is designed for students, educators, and professionals seeking to deepen their understanding of this vital discipline.
Scope and Structure
This book encompasses a wide range of topics, from the basic concepts of polymer chemistry and physics to advanced applications in various fields such as materials science, engineering, and biotechnology. The chapters are thoughtfully organized to facilitate learning, beginning with foundational principles of polymerization and progressing through synthesis methods, properties, processing techniques, and real-world applications. Each section is crafted to ensure clarity and accessibility, making complex concepts understandable without sacrificing depth.
Interdisciplinary Collaboration
The contributions in this volume reflect the collaborative efforts of experts from diverse backgrounds. By integrating perspectives from chemistry, materials science, engineering, and environmental studies, we aim to present a holistic view of polymer science. This interdisciplinary approach is crucial as it mirrors the collaborative nature of modern research and development in the field. The authors collectively emphasize the importance of understanding both the science behind polymers and their practical implications in technology and industry.
Real-World Applications
Polymers are integral to countless products we encounter daily, from packaging materials to medical devices. This book highlights the versatility of polymers by discussing their roles in various applications, including sustainable materials development, biomedical engineering, and nanotechnology. By bridging theoretical knowledge with practical applications, we hope to inspire readers to explore innovative solutions that leverage polymer science for societal benefit.
